Meghalaya’s All Khasi Hills Tourist Taxi Association seeks Reciprocal Transport Agreement with Assam

Shillong: The All Khasi Hills Tourist Taxi Association (AKMTTA) has urged the Meghalaya government to implement a Reciprocal Transport Agreement (RTA) to streamline tourist transportation between Meghalaya and Assam.

The proposal was put forth during a meeting organized by the State Tourism Department on Friday.

Balajied Jyrwa, the secretary of AKMTTA, highlighted the need for Meghalaya’s inclusion in the RTA framework with Assam to facilitate smoother cross-border tourist travel.

“The primary outcome of the meeting was our strong push for the implementation of the RTA in our state. This will significantly improve the movement of tourist vehicles between Assam and Meghalaya,” Jyrwa stated.

In addition to RTA, discussions were held on the issuance of temporary permits for vehicles. The AKMTTA addressed concerns raised by its members regarding the efficiency and fairness of these permits, aiming to ensure equitable access to operational rights in the tourism sector.

Another key demand from the association was for the state government to integrate various organizations under the AKMTTA into the Tourism Department’s app.

Jyrwa emphasized the importance of app-based listings, stating that it would provide local operators with a fair opportunity to engage with tourists and enhance their visibility.

Tourism Director Cyril Diengdoh, who chaired the meeting, assured that the government is taking concrete steps to elevate the tourism experience. He announced the decision to develop an app that will list all tourist taxi associations, their drivers, and the routes they operate on.

“This app will serve as a one-stop platform for tourists, offering them a convenient way to hire drivers while ensuring transparency,” Diengdoh said.

The app will also play a crucial role in enabling tourists to make informed decisions when engaging with local services.

Recognizing the evolving role of drivers as guides and transportation providers, the state government has planned to implement a comprehensive training program for drivers across associations. A list of drivers will be compiled to facilitate this initiative.
